What is the difference between Assistant Coder vs Medical Coder?

AspectAssistant CoderMedical Coder
CredentialsHigh school diploma, on-the-job trainingCertification (e.g., CPC, CCS)
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, physician officesHospitals, outpatient facilities, insurance companies
Employer & Industry UsageEntry-level support role in healthcare billingSpecialized role for coding and billing accuracy
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level coding rolesProfessional coding responsibilities

Assistant Coders typically perform basic coding tasks under supervision, often with minimal certifications. Medical Coders are more experienced, usually certified, and handle complex coding processes independently. Both roles are essential in healthcare billing but differ in qualifications and responsibilities.

Purpose of Position
The Coder is responsible for reviewing and coding patient records in accordance with standardized medical coding systems, ensuring the accuracy and compliance of all medical documentation. The role requires a strong understanding of medical terminology, coding systems (such as 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S), and health information regulations (such as HIPAA). This role will play a critical role in facilitating efficient billing, reimbursement, and compliance processes.
Duties and Responsibilities
Essential Functions

  • Review and analyze patient medical records to assign accurate diagnostic and procedural codes (ICD-10, CPT, HCPCS).
  • Ensure that all codes are applied according to established coding guidelines and regulations.
  • Verify and update patient information in the electronic health record (EHR) system.
  • Collaborate with healthcare providers to clarify documentation, resolve discrepancies, and ensure complete and accurate coding.
  • Maintain knowledge of current medical coding practices, policies, and regulations.
  • Adhere to HIPAA and confidentiality standards while handling sensitive patient information.
  • Assist with auditing and internal reviews to ensure the quality and accuracy of medical records.
  • Communicate with insurance companies, healthcare providers, and billing departments regarding coding issues.
  • Stay updated on changes in coding standards, insurance billing procedures, and relevant healthcare laws.
  • Provide support and training to staff regarding coding processes and requirements, as needed.
Marginal Functions
  • Other duties as assigned
Skills, Knowledge, and Abilities
  • Certification as a Medical Coder (e.g., CPC, CCS, or CCA) is required.
  • Proven experience in medical coding or health information management.
  • Strong understanding of medical terminology, anatomy, and procedures.
  • Proficiency in coding software, electronic health records (EHR), and Microsoft Office Suite.
  • Knowledge of healthcare regulations, including HIPAA.
  • Exceptional att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Strong communication and problem-solving skills.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ced environment.
  • Must be able to see clearly with or without corrective lenses and hear clearly with or without aids.
  • Must be able to use hands, fingers and wrists, repetitively, using a computer keyboard and other office equipment, regularly.
  • Must be able to proficiently speak, read and write in English.
